Output 42efc1f145ddf9ef28a199b7baa0ae5fffc623e730da679031e3ca20d1754e63:1

value
137916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6961c37414bb38b16fe838305f7f09a16567d5ac OP_EQUAL
address
3BJDzQsHqFmcisHPQw4iojwcs7z1rsqv1g
transaction
42efc1f145ddf9ef28a199b7baa0ae5fffc623e730da679031e3ca20d1754e63
spent
true